Ferrari FF (2011) at 2011 Geneva motor show
Fri, 04 Feb 2011This, believe it or not, is the new Ferrari FF – it’s the Prancing Horse’s replacement for the Ferrari 612 Scaglietti. FF stands for Ferrari Four, to designate that this new GT features both four seats and Ferrari’s first ever four-wheel drive system. Why has Ferrari built this car?
2012 Ford Focus ST gets 297bhp
Fri, 30 Nov 2012Those clever chaps at SuperChips have given the 2012 Ford Focus ST a bit of an ECU tweak to deliver 297bhp and an extra 85lb/ft of torque. When we reported last week that WTC outfit Arena had in roped Ford’s tuner of choice, Mountune, to give the new Ford Focus a makeover, we were a tad disappointed to discover that they were tweaking the rather journeyman Focus Zetec S. That meant the Zetec S got 200bhp – a handy jump – but we bemoaned the fact that they hadn’t fiddled with the Focus ST to give us a car to fill the void left by the absence of a Focus RS in the current iteration of the Focus.
2013 Lamborghini Gallardo IS the last Gallardo (video)
Tue, 11 Dec 2012Lamborghini has finally confirmed the Gallardo is now at the end of its life, with the 2013 Gallardo the ‘Final Gallardo’. But the Lamborghini Gallardo is anything but new as it’s been with us for a decade and, although still selling remarkably well, is well past its sell-by date. So we’d half expected that Paris may have seen the first sight of the Gallardo’s replacement rather than a mildly titivated version of the current car, but that now seems likely to happen at the Geneva Motor Show in 2013 after Lamborghini put up a website this week – The Final Gallardo – leaving us in no doubt the Gallardo’s time is up.
